Description

Issued by Coeur in Germany. This is a Poker sized deck with 52 cards + 3 jokers. The cards are 5.8 cm x 8.8 cm. Publicity deck for DSR, Deutsche Seereederei Rostock, an East German sea-going shipping company. Drawings by artist KLAUS ENSIKAT that relate to sailing and the city of Rostock. On the Aces are sea monsters. The harbour is the heart of the maritime city of Rostock. Although there may be fewer sailors on the quayside these days, the harbour still shapes the character of the city. It is the largest city in the north German state Mecklenburg-Vorpommern and located on the Warnow river; the quarter of Warnemünde 12 km north of the city centre is directly located at the coast of the Baltic Sea. This is the second deck illustrated by Klaus Ensikat for DSR. The first was made in 1976 and featured figures all reflecting the city of Rostock & its aspect on the sea.
